A side-by-side view of publicly reported data for these two schools.

Nathanael Greene Middle
Esek Hopkins Middle
  • Nathanael Greene Middle reported a higher students per counselor than Esek Hopkins Middle (226.5:1 vs. 136.1:1).
  • Esek Hopkins Middle reported a higher violent incidents than Nathanael Greene Middle (252 vs. 171).
  • Nathanael Greene Middle reported a higher chronically absent students than Esek Hopkins Middle (378 vs. 298).
